Governor Okorocha’s Urban Renewal Programme for Orlu Kicks Off

orlu-urban-renewal

At  last, Governor  Okorocha’s promise  to  Orlu  populace during  his   Thanksgiving  Mass  at  Holy  Trinity   Cathedral   immediately  after   his   victory in the   2015   Governorship  election   that  “Orlu Will Wear a New Look”   has  finally  kicked  off to the   joy, applause, and celebration  of  the  populace in Orlu municipality.

According to  a  press  release by  the Area Information  Officer, Orlu Local  Government  Area, Martin.O.Onunaku, the  bulldozers,  caterpillars  and  earth-moving  equipment  for the “Urban Renewal Programme “ in Orlu  municipality have  arrived  the  city  centre and   work  swiftly commenced  under  the  watchful   monitoring  of the  ebullient   Transition  Council  Chairman,of Orlu Local Government  Area, Chief Obinna Onyeocha and the Commissioner  for Rural Development, Chief Jerry  Okolie who  represented  the  irrepressible  State  Governor, DR.Rochas Okorocha.

The  event  commenced as  the flag-off of the major rural  link for  rehabilitation and  construction  was  launched at the Ohafor Okporo-Umutanze road by the  the  Commissioner  for Rural   Development,Chief Jerry  Okolie and the  ebullient   Transition  Chairman  of  Orlu Local Government Area,

The ceremony witnessed a large turn-out of Party Faithful, State, Development Council(SDC) Co-ordinators, Political leaders, Traditional rulers, Community leaders and officials of Orlu Local Government, some of whom used the forum to extol the unique qualities, charisma and development strides of the Governor OwelleRochasAnayoOkorocha.

Speaking at the occasion, the Honourable Commissioner, Chief Jerry Okolie assured the  massive   crowd  gathered   to  witness the  great  event of the resolve and promise made by His Excellency to complete all remaining road projects which   will  commence with the following roads:-

  1. Umuowa – Owerre-Umudioka – Umuzike – Eziachi roads
  2. Sabbath Mission – OhaforOkporo – Umutanze – School of Health roads,
  3. All Saints Okwuabala – Green Uzo Secondary School – Acharaba roads,
  4. S.C – Amike – Amaokpara – MgbaboAno roads,
  5. Township Primary School – Alhaji Tijani – Carrot Junction Amaigbo roads.

He stated that the approval of the Government has been received and the funds provided for commencement of work for the above roads and praised the Governor for making good his promises he gave when stakeholders from the L.G.A. visited him over the Christmas period.

Honourable Jerry observed that with work on these roads, Orlu L.G.A. will feel the impact of the on-going massive rural roads rehabilitation in the state and pleaded with the people to safe-guard all equipments for the work. He also asked for continued support of the people to the rescue mission government.

Contributing, the T.C. Chairman, Chief ObinnaOnyeocha, expressed joy that the whole thing is happening at his time and observed that the Governor has shown great love for Orlu people with the approval of the roads and by releasing funds for the immediate commencement of work.

He added that apart from the 5 major roads, some other ancillary ones both in the urban and rural areas are to be included. He  therefore enjoined the people of the area to continue to support the government in its  efforts  to   actualize  this  laudable  project of  giving  Orlu a  new  look.

In another development, the T.C. Chairman of Orlu L.G.A. Chief Obinna Onyeocha has instructed all street traders along Amaigbo road, OWUS Avenue and all adjoining streets including all food stuff traders at old Orie Ugwu to move into the stalls at old Onitsha park shopping Mall and the old Orie Umuna shopping complex immediately as government has concluded all arrangements to pull down all illegal structures and clear up all areas to make way for commencement of the rehabilitation work.

He also directed all the timber dealers, building materials traders and electronics dealers to move into the specific markets designated for them as the taskforce already set up to enforce compliance to the above will commence work latest by next week and all defaulters will have their wares confiscated.
